Hemerocallis Joan Senior is a semi-evergreen clump-forming perennial with arching blade-like leaves and smooth flowering scapes. Large near-white, gently ruffled flowers open in succession, each revealing a soft lime-green throat.
Grow it in full sun or partial shade in fertile, moist but well-drained soil. The cultivar tolerates summer heat and humidity, but deep watering during dry spells keeps the foliage attractive and supports its long May-to-July display.
